--- Comment #7 from David Cook <[email protected]> --- Also note that you will have to individually set up each index that you want to use for facet queries. As per this email from an IndexData person: http://lists.indexdata.dk/pipermail/zebralist/2007-July/001694.html In general, this shouldn't case a problem, since we only use a short list of facets. However, it would create a barrier to allowing users to customize their results. In theory, we could list all or most of the available indexes in the Zebra config files. Then, we could use a system preference or a DB table to choose which indexes we want to use for facets. This would generate the "elements" string that we pass to Zebra everytime we want our facets. Actually, now that I think about it...that might not be a bad idea. We already have that Search.pm sub where we're manually keeping track of indexes, so we could keep that or use something similar to fill an HTML list and have that create our Zebra facet string. So long as we generate the string once and then use it multiple times...that should be all right. We could also have a hardcoded fallback string in case someone deletes the facet config in Koha or if their facet config is bad. Hmm. Ideas. Ideas.
